Israel has occupied the Palestinian territories (the West Bank and the Gaza Strip) since 1967.After decades of conflict, the Fatah-controlled Palestinian Authority was created in 1994 following the agreements of the Oslo Accords between the Palestine Liberation Organization (PLO) and Israel.
